Output 5947d840757dd338f677773974dfe1b54f4916c7bde3b553dc39da5e767d91c2:1

value
635296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31874de30ac538ee465873fa4dfd1fc94625e678 OP_EQUAL
address
36Cu83hBTkFnpsZcroX4jAWZSbzQSQ5u43
transaction
5947d840757dd338f677773974dfe1b54f4916c7bde3b553dc39da5e767d91c2
confirmations
334448
spent
true